Whales are entities with large sums of money and we track their transactions here at Benzinga on our options activity scanner.

Traders will search for circumstances when the market estimation of an option diverges heavily from its normal worth. High amounts of trading activity could push option prices to exaggerated or underestimated levels.

Options Alert Terminology

\- Call Contracts: The right to buy shares as indicated in the contract.

\- Put Contracts: The right to sell shares as indicated in the contract.

\- Expiration Date: When the contract expires. One must act on the contract by this date if one wants to use it.

\- Premium/Option Price: The price of the contract.
